What is true love? Is It Valentine’s Day?What is true love? Is It Valentine’s Day?What is true love? Is It Valentine’s Day?What is true love? Is It Valentine’s Day? By now, you’re probably seeing Valentine’s Day promoted on television
and in stores. Many people call it the “holiday day of love.” Commercials and
advertisements encourage people to buy greeting cards, jewelry, flowers, or
heart shaped boxes of
candy to show their
love to those they care
about. But is Valen-
tine’s Day really the
“holiday day of love”?
The short answer is no.
Yahweh does not con-
done our participation
in pagan holidays. In
modern times, Valen-
tine’s Day is also a
money making ploy to
get people to spend money. We are made to feel guilty if we don’t buy the
people we love presents. But what does the Bible say about true love? Does
the Bible say that heart shaped boxes of candy really shows our love to peo-
ple? No! The absolute best way to show people love is to tell them that you
love them! And serving one another is also a good way. Being nice to one
another is also a way to express love. Of course there is nothing wrong with
giving gifts to one another, but the Bible mentions more important ways to
show love. Yahweh showed the ultimate example of true love when He sent
His Son Yahshua to die for our sins, so that we may be saved.
In closing, let’s read 1 Corinthians 13:4-8a (NIV), “Love is patient, love is
kind. It does not envy, it does not boast, it is not proud. It is not rude, it is not
self seeking, it is not easily angered, it keeps no record of wrongs. Love does
not delight in evil but rejoices with the truth. It always protects, always trusts,
always hopes, always perseveres. Love never fails.”

Who did Yahshua tell, “Sell all that you have and follow me”? (Luke 18:22).
Whom did Yahshua call out of the tomb? (John 11:43).
To whom did Yahshua say “Come and eat”? (John 21:12).
To whom did Yahshua say, “I will make you fishers of men? (Mark1: 16-17).
Who saw a vision and heard a man cry, “Come over to Macedonia and help us”? (Acts 16:9).
Who asked Yahshua where he lived and He replied, “Come and see”? (John 1:35-37).
To whom did Yahshua say, “Do not prevent the children from coming to me”? (Mark 10:13-14).
To whom did Yahshua say, “Come unto me and I will give you rest”? (Matthew 11:28).
To whom did Yahweh say, “Come into the ark with all your household”? (Genesis 7:1).
Yahshua’s invitation to “Come...take the water of life freely” is issued to whom? (Revelation 22:17).
To whom did Yahshua say to “make haste, and come down; for I must come to your house to-day”? (Luke 19:5).
